Skip to content
This repository was archived by the owner on Jan 16, 2018. It is now read-only.

Conversation

@sagikazarmark
Copy link
Member

No description provided.

composer.json Outdated
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

can we avoid this dependency? i guess if we would use the guzzle promises, or put them into a separate repo. but then its a lot of repos.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

The EmulateAsyncClient uses two traits from the Tools repo. Also, the promises are moved to the tools repo as well, which are used in the same class.

@sagikazarmark sagikazarmark force-pushed the implementation_separation branch 2 times, most recently from 5f78bfe to 70f007c Compare December 15, 2015 13:21
EmulateAsyncClient uses helper traits

Use client tools package

Remove EmulateAsyncClient and client-tools dependency
@sagikazarmark sagikazarmark force-pushed the implementation_separation branch from 70f007c to 16018c3 Compare December 15, 2015 13:24
sagikazarmark added a commit that referenced this pull request Dec 15, 2015
Move Promises and Async/Sync Emulators/Decorators to client-tools
@sagikazarmark sagikazarmark merged commit c0b186e into master Dec 15, 2015
@sagikazarmark sagikazarmark deleted the implementation_separation branch December 15, 2015 13:25
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ants